Who was Sharaud? How does Ms. Gruwell describe him?

English
1 answer:
jok3333 [9.3K]3 years ago
3 0

Answer: A disciplinary transfer, violence-prone student

Explanation:

Sharaud was a student in Ms. Gruwell's first-class and he was also a disciplinary transferred one. He is known as a violence-prone student who intimidates his teachers.

He was interrupting classroom teachings very much, he was also tall and imposing. He was not having that good behavior

What was the Jazz age
Verdich [7]

The Jazz Age was a post-World War I movement in the 1920s from which jazz music and dance emerged. Although the era ended with the outset of the Great Depression in 1929, jazz has lived on in American popular culture.
